Hi There, Let me post my results first and then you can read my background.

------ RESULTS START ------ Triglycerides = 1.1 mmol/l HDL Cholest = 1.1 mmol/l LDL Cholest = 4.7 mmol/l High Sensitive CRP = 0.8 mg/l

Glucose Fasting = 5.0 mmol/l HbA1c (DCCT/NGSP) = 5.1% HbA1c (IFCC) = 32 mmol/mol Insulin Fasting = 8.9 mIU/l Homa Index = 1.98

TSH (Roche) = 1.48 mIU/l Free T4 (Roche) = 24 pmol/l Free T3 (Roche) = 5.0 pmol/l

25-OH Vitamin D = 27.0 ng/ml ------ RESULTS END ------

I read Robb Wolf's book the Paleo solution and took up the 30day challenge..And I have been doing this for about 3months now. I have genetically high colesterol.

I stopped taking my Supplements (Omega 3 (2000mg Daily) and Polycosanol x2 daily (http://www.solaltech.com/ing/ProdResult.php). I have included a link to the supplement. I also used to take a general multivitamin daily. My LDL cholesterol was 2.9 2years ago when I was tested, but has gone up to 4.7.

Paleo is tough so due to this, I often eat French Fries and Grilled Chicken Thighs with the skin. Other than this I try and eat as much Grass Fed Beef as possible with the fat, 3 x eggs a day. Venison Mince and other venison meats.

I have started taking Polycosanol again as well as high dose of Omega 3 - 2.8g contains 860mg EPA and 580mg of DHA.

My doctor want to see me about my results, im assuming its beacuase of my elevated LDL.
